§ 935.140 Motor vehicle maintenance and equipment. (a) Each person who has custody of a motor vehicle on Wake Island shall present that vehicle for periodic safety inspection, as required by the Commander. (b) No person may operate a motor vehicle on Wake Island unless it is in a condition that the Commander considers to be safe and operable. (c) No person may operate a motor vehicle on Wake Island unless it is equipped with an adequate and properly functioning— (1) Horn; (2) Wiper, for any windshield; (3) Rear vision mirror; (4) Headlights and taillights; (5) Brakes; (6) Muffler; (7) Spark or ignition noise suppressors; and (8) Safety belts. (d) No person may operate a motor vehicle on Wake Island if that vehicle is equipped with a straight exhaust or muffler cutoff.
